Why you should visit Cafe Yell during your visit to New Delhi

Stylish, uber chic and hipster - the three things that come to mind when one steps into Cafe Yell.  Located in Defence Colony market, the cafe is barely months old. It is owned by Vipul and Divya Gupta, who are also the proprietors of the Yell clothing store which mainly deals with items made of pure linen. Thus, elements of a tailoring shop, including a measuring tape, colorful thread spools, different-sized buttons, and stencils are used here as decorative items. 

Steel chairs with colorful cushions, wooden tables, and custom-made wooden lamps give it the hipster feel.  "Cafe Yell is mainly an amalgamation of two things we really love - food and clothes. We want the feel of a neighborhood cafe where people can come for a quick bite after shopping or work," Vipul said. 

According to Vipul, their menu is quite limited but with options. "So a person can opt for a sandwich or a full 'laal maas' (traditional Rajasthani mutton dish) meal. We have something for everybody."  

Start off with a Kit Kat Caramel shake. It is light, refreshing and not overly sweet. A must try.  The next were the jalapeno mozzarella bombs. The name of this dish basically says it all. With a size similar to an arancini, the gooey goodness of the cheese and the slight spice from the jalapeno make this the perfect starter.

Cafe Yell specializes in pizzas.  And 'laal maas' is their signature dish. It comes with a spice-level warning though.  With succulent pieces of mutton used as toppings, the pizza base has the laal maas gravy. It definitely stands out for its uniqueness but if you are eating this then also order a sweet lemonade, it will come in handy.

However, the stars of the show were definitely the desserts. The Yell cookie blast is a cheesecake with layers of chocolate topped with nuts and chocolate fudge. It is pure indulgence.  Cafe Yell also has a separate breakfast menu that starts at 8 a.m., onwards. "Just come here with a book and have a cup of coffee with a piece of cake or a sandwich, you won't be disappointed," Vipul added.

FAQs:

Where: 35, Ground Floor, Defence Colony Market, Defence Colony, New Delhi

Timings: 8 a.m. - 11.30 p.m.

Price for two: Rs 1,000 (approx)
